Introduction to Diameter Measuring Tools

In industrial manufacturing and mechanical engineering, accurate measurement of component dimensions is essential for ensuring product quality and performance. Among various measurement tasks, diameter measurement is one of the most critical.

Diameter measuring tools for industrial use are specifically designed to measure the internal and external diameters of cylindrical components such as pipes, shafts, bearings, and holes. These tools are widely used in machining, automotive production, and equipment maintenance.

Using a reliable diameter measuring tool helps reduce errors, improve assembly accuracy, and ensure that components meet strict engineering tolerances.

What Is a Diameter Measuring Tool?

A diameter measuring tool is a type of measuring device used to determine the diameter of round objects. Depending on the application, these tools can measure:

  • External diameter (OD)

  • Internal diameter (ID)

  • Depth and bore dimensions

Precision is critical in diameter measurement, especially in industries where even small deviations can affect product performance.

Common Types of Diameter Measuring Tools for Industrial Use

Vernier Calipers

Vernier calipers are widely used diameter measuring tools capable of measuring both internal and external diameters.

Key features:

  • High measurement accuracy

  • Multi-function measurement (ID, OD, depth)

  • Durable mechanical structure

They are commonly used in workshops, factories, and inspection environments.

Digital Calipers

Digital calipers are modern precision measurement tools that provide electronic readings for easier measurement.

Advantages include:

  • Clear digital display

  • Fast measurement reading

  • Easy unit conversion

These tools are widely used in industrial production and quality control processes.

Micrometers

Micrometers are highly accurate measuring devices used for measuring small diameters and thicknesses.

Types include:

  • Outside micrometers (external diameter)

  • Inside micrometers (internal diameter)

  • Bore micrometers

Micrometers are essential in high-precision industries such as aerospace and automotive manufacturing.

Bore Gauges

Bore gauges are specialized diameter measuring tools for industrial use designed to measure the internal diameter of holes and cylinders.

Applications include:

  • Engine cylinder inspection

  • Pipe and tube measurement

  • Precision machining

Bore gauges provide highly accurate readings for internal dimensions.

Laser Diameter Measuring Instruments

Laser-based measuring devices are advanced tools used for non-contact diameter measurement.

Benefits include:

  • High-speed measurement

  • Non-contact operation

  • Suitable for continuous production lines

These tools are commonly used in automated industrial environments.

Choosing the Right Diameter Measuring Tool

Selecting the correct diameter measuring tool depends on several factors.

Measurement Type

Choose tools based on whether you need to measure internal or external diameters.

Accuracy Requirements

For high-precision applications, use micrometers or advanced measuring devices.

Working Environment

For industrial production lines, non-contact laser measuring tools may be more suitable.

Ease of Use

Digital tools provide faster readings and reduce operator error.
